By the editors · 2 min readDolce & Gabbana Pour Homme 2012 occupies a well-worn formal register with quiet confidence. Neroli and bergamot open with a clean, slightly citrus-floral brightness — a little waxy from the neroli, nothing aggressive. Sage and lavender in the heart form the backbone of a classic fougère structure: herbal, slightly medicinal in the best sense, unambiguously masculine without being loud.
Tonka bean and tobacco ground the drydown in a sweet, smoky warmth that reads more distinguished than heavy. The overall composition is disciplined and linear, a well-made daily masculine that ages gracefully across a full workday.
